Testing generalized second law of thermodynamics in cosmological models with bulk viscosity and modified gravity
Abstract This study examines the validity of the Generalized Second Law of Thermodynamics (GSLT) to generalized Chaplygin gas (GCG) and modified Chaplygin gas (MCG) models within the general relativity(GR) framework and modified gravity framework namely the f(T) gravity.
